Norway After the 22/7 Killings
JULY 2011
Photo: Paul S. Amundsen for Bergens Tidende
On July 22, 2011 77 people were killed in a bomb attack in central Oslo and a shooting rampage
on Utoya. Three days after the massacre, Anders Behring Breivik, who is charged for both of the
incidents, appeared in court in a closed hearing. This is a serie of portraits of people
outside the court during the hearing in Oslo. See the portraits here.

Exhibition and book release
2009
The cover of the book Sort of Safe.
I am one of 15 participants in the photo book Sort of Safe. Sort of Safe is the result of the Nordic Master Class workshop where 15 photographers from the Nordic countries were making visual stories about the Nordic welfare states. Pictures from the book are exhbited at the Town Hall in Århus (from 31.08). The pictures will also be exhibited in other Nordic countries in 2009. Here is my contribution to the book.

Exhibited in Denmark
2009
The exhibited portrait: Diane.
This portrait was exhibited at Portrait Now (7. May-2. August), Det Nationalhistoriske Museum, Denmark.
Portrait Now! is the exhibition for the selected entries for Brewer J.C. Jacobsens Portrait Award.,
and the picture will also be exhibited in the other Nordic countries:
Sweden: Ljungbergmuseet, Ljungby, May - July 2010
Iceland: Akureyri Kunstmuseum, Akureyri, October - December 2010
Finland: Tikanojas konsthem, KUNSTI, Vaasa, January - March 2011
Norway: Norsk Folkemuseum, Oslo, April - August 2011
